Mixed day for Oman at Asian Beach Games in Vietnam

Muscat: Oman teams had a mixed day at the fifth Asian Beach Games in the Vietnamese city of Danang on Sunday.
According to information received here, Oman beach soccer team suffered defeat while the Sultanate’s handball squad started their campaign with a well-deserved victory. In the beach volleyball too Oman experienced mixed results.
In the beach soccer competition, Talib Hilal-coached Oman side were outlasted by Lebanon via penalty shootout.
The teams were locked 3-3 at the end of regulation time in but the Lebanon kept their cool in the ensuing shootout and won the honours with a 2-0 margin.
Oman play their next match against Qatar on Tuesday.
In the beach handball field, Oman were dominant in their Group B match against Sri Lanka and they capped their dominance with a 18-11, 21-10 victory.
For Oman, Nasr Khamis Al Tamtami scored eight goals while Usama Al Kasbi and Asad Al Hasani scored four goals each.
In the beach volleyball competition, both the Oman teams were in action on Sunday but only one managed to record a victory.
Badr Al Subhi and Nooh Al Jaloobi were beaten 21-10, 21-18 by the duo of Davaa and Sainaa from Mongolia.
However, the Omani duo of Haitham Al Shuraiqi and Ahmed Al Hassani defeated Japan’s Masito and Morno with identical scores of 21-13, 21-13.
